The BRIAN WILSON ON TOUR DVD was edited to show Brian at his most enthusiastic; it would not be representative of his overall behavior/attitude during that time period.

It's been pointed out a number of times, but Brian won't really go along with something he is dead-set against. I'm sure there are still aspects of touring he enjoys, but ultimately he is just doing his job, a job he knows will keep him active. Like for any of us, a job can become a drudgery, but it's something we stick with because it keeps us busy and keeps money coming in. In Brian's case, the money is not so much an issue, but keeping busy is. Unlike most other performers (who will fib about how life on the road is always fantastic), Brian has been vocal about what a drag it can be. That doesn't mean he is being forced against his will to perform. When you go to see him in concert, he's doing his job for you; sometimes, nothing more. I've seen him "do his job" as a solo artist seven times now and thought he put forth a decent effort each time. Your job as an audience member is to enjoy the performance as much as you can.

I actually paid to do a TM course when I was 19, this was 16 years ago and it cost me around £100.  The only discernible difference I can see between TM and any other form of meditation (that you can do for free), is that you are given your own personal mantra. I remember being asked to take an orange, this was some kind of symbolic offering, to what or whom, I don't remember!? I'm not saying the whole thing is valueless, but I don't see what all the mystique (and money) is about, it's just the repetition of a mantra, which surely we can all do for free!?
